Determine whether each of the following statements about the thermodynamic functions are True or False as they apply to chemical reactions.


True False  Negative entropy changes increase spontaneity.
True False  Positive enthalpy changes increase spontaneity.
True False  Entropy and enthalpy are included in the Gibbs free energy.
True False  All spontaneous chemical reactions have positive entropy changes.
True False  The heat of reaction at constant volume is always equal to the heat of reaction at constant pressure.

Explanation / Answer

1.Negative entropy changes increase spontaneity. ---- False,

Spontaneity of reaction does not depend on system entropy. entropy increases in universe must be +ve for spontaneity run.

2. Positive enthalpy changes increase spontaneity. ----- False.

Run spontaneity does not depend on enthalpy.

3. Entropy and enthalpy are included in the Gibbs free energy. ---- True.

We know G= H-TS

4. All spontaneous Chemical rxn have positive entropy changes. ---- False.

For spontaneous rxn, delt G value is -Ve.

For spontaneous run, delta S value of universe + ve.

5.The heat of reaction at constant volume is always equal to the heat of reaction at constant pressure. -----False.

Delta U= nCvdT

Delta H= nCpdT. For ideal gas , Cp-Cv=nR
